Popular Toyota Models in Qatar
The popularity of Toyota models in Qatar varies depending on factors such as consumer preferences, market trends, and specific model features. A diverse range of models cater to various needs and budgets.
Model | Popularity Rationale |
---|---|
RAV4 | Known for its versatility, fuel efficiency, and spacious interior, appealing to a wide range of consumers. |
Camry | A popular sedan model, often favored for its comfort, reliability, and value for money. |
Hilux | A highly sought-after pick-up truck, recognized for its durability, capability, and utility in the Qatari market. |
Yaris | A compact car model, favored for its fuel efficiency, affordability, and maneuverability. |
Corolla | A classic sedan model, known for its reliability, affordability, and extensive availability of features, making it a top choice. |

Comparison of Toyota Models
Model | Price (Estimated) | Fuel Efficiency (Estimated MPG) | Safety Ratings (NHTSA/IIHS) |
---|---|---|---|
Corolla | QAR 60,000 – 90,000 | 30-35 MPG | 4-5 Stars (depending on specific model year) |
Camry | QAR 90,000 – 130,000 | 35-40 MPG | 4-5 Stars (depending on specific model year) |
RAV4 | QAR 100,000 – 160,000 | 30-35 MPG (Hybrid versions higher) | 4-5 Stars (depending on specific model year) |
Hilux | QAR 80,000 – 150,000 | 20-25 MPG | 4-5 Stars (depending on specific model year) |
Note: Prices and fuel efficiency are estimated and may vary based on specific trim levels and options. Safety ratings are based on available data and may vary depending on the specific model year.

Toyota Service Options
Service Type | Description | Typical Cost (Approximate) |
---|---|---|
Routine Maintenance | Oil changes, tire rotations, filter replacements, etc. | QAR 100-QAR 500+ |
Major Repairs | Engine repairs, transmission repairs, body work | QAR 1000+ depending on the nature and extent of the repair |
Parts Replacement | Replacing worn-out parts with genuine Toyota parts | Variable, depending on the part |
Extended Warranty | Additional coverage beyond the standard warranty period | Variable, depending on the plan chosen |
Proactive Maintenance Schedules | Scheduled service appointments for preventative maintenance. | Variable, based on the schedule |
Note: Prices are approximate and can vary based on specific service requirements and the individual dealership.
